Dispatch desk — please schedule collection of the printed museum labels for the new Tidemark Gallery at the Orrell Maritime Museum. The labels are packed in three flat archival boxes, marked TG-1 through TG-3, and are staged on the warehouse mezzanine. Shift lead: the boxes must stay horizontal and dry, and all three travel together on one run. The courier from Lanthorn Couriers arrives at 11:00. At hand-over, give the courier this instruction exactly.

handover note for yagef-bagep: the drudor pelius courier leaves the kasdor zorvan norir ledger at gate 8016 under passcode 755406

Action item: The Furrowlink telemetry gateway dropped heartbeat packets from roughly 300 combines in the Westden region after the firmware 4.2 rollout. Root cause: keepalive interval mismatch between gateway and edge units. Mitigation shipped, but on-call must now watch the heartbeat-gap dashboard during any firmware push and roll back if gaps exceed 5% for ten minutes. Rollback takes one command; do not wait for approval. Full rollback steps and dashboard links are on the page below.

wiki page, tahaf-tajog: https://jira.ordindyn.corp/pipeline

## Tuning

The Tallygrove loyalty-points ledger batches accrual writes and reconciles balances on a fixed cadence. Most performance issues trace back to batch size or reconciliation interval, not the datastore itself. Raising batch size improves throughput but widens the window for duplicate-award retries, so change both together. Flush thresholds were calibrated against last quarter's peak redemption traffic. The defaults shipped with this release are shown here.

tuning table, kajog-kawef:
PRIORITIES = {
    "kelox": 870,
    "kasix": 89,
    "eliax": 988,
}